Java 是一種流行的編程語言,常用于開發 Web 應用程序。在 Web 應用程序中,經常需要將 Java 實體類轉換為 JSON 字符串。JSON 是一種輕量級的數據格式,廣泛用于 Web 應用程序中傳遞數據。
在 Java 中,我們可以使用許多開源的庫來實現實體類轉 JSON。其中,最著名的是 Google 開源的 Gson 庫。Gson 庫是一個功能強大而又易于使用的庫,可以將任何 Java 對象轉換為 JSON 字符串。
下面是一個使用 Gson 庫將 Java 實體類轉換為 JSON 字符串的示例:
import com.google.gson.Gson; public class Entity { private int id; private String name; // getters and setters public static void main(String[] args) { Entity entity = new Entity(); entity.setId(1); entity.setName("John Doe"); Gson gson = new Gson(); String json = gson.toJson(entity); System.out.println(json); // {"id":1,"name":"John Doe"} } }
在上面的示例中,我們創建了一個名為 Entity 的實體類,并使用 Gson 庫將其轉換為 JSON 字符串。我們首先創建了一個 Entity 對象并設置了 id 和 name 屬性,然后創建了一個 Gson 對象。最后,通過調用 toJson() 方法將 Entity 對象轉換為 JSON 字符串。
總之,Java 實體類轉換為 JSON 字符串是在 Web 開發中必不可少的。通過使用開源的 Gson 庫,我們可以輕松地將 Java 實體類轉換為 JSON 字符串,并在 Web 應用程序中傳遞數據。
下一篇css 定位到屏幕中間